advice |
an idea or opinion that someone gives to help you decide. |
boat |
an open vehicle, smaller than a ship, that moves on water. |
boot |
a covering for the foot and lower part of the leg, usually made of leather or rubber. |
clothing |
things that you wear to cover the body; clothes. |
cord |
a covered wire that carries electricity to a piece of equipment such as a television or lamp. |
dawn |
the first light of day that appears in the morning. |
front |
the most forward part or side of something. |
heavy |
having much weight. |
narrow |
not wide. |
sleep |
to be in a state of rest for the body and mind. When people sleep, their eyes are closed and they are not conscious. |
square |
a flat, closed figure with four straight sides of equal length and four equal corners. |
strap |
a thin, flat strip of material used to attach something or hold objects in a certain way. |
stroke |
a single mark made in writing or painting, or the act of making such a mark. |
tiptoe |
the end or tip of the toe. |
trade |
to give in return for something else; exchange. |
